Earlestown Station is equipped with various facilities to enhance passenger experience. Ticket purchasing is made simple with a ticket office open from 06:00 to midnight on weekdays and from 08:30 to midnight on Sundays. For those who prefer a more automated approach, ticket machines, including accessible ones, are available on-site. The station also supports technology with induction loops and smartcard validators for quick and easy transit.
The station has taken steps towards accessibility, although it falls under Category B with some limitations. Step-free access is available on select platforms, and ramps for train access are provided. Unfortunately, the lack of step-free access to certain platforms and absence of waiting rooms and toilets pose challenges for some passengers. Despite these limitations, the station strives to offer customer help points and available staff assistance during operating hours.
Beyond rail services, Earlestown Station connects passengers to various transport modes. Bus services are reachable through the dedicated line at Busline 0871 200 2233. For those preferring cars, limited parking is free and open 24/7. While the station offers no bicycle hire yet, bike stands are available for travelers who wish to cycle to the station.
Should there be a need for a taxi, Northern offers a convenient booking service via their Cab4You platform. Rail replacement services are situated on Railway Street, ensuring continuity of travel during train disruptions.

The station provides essential facilities for a comfortable travel experience. Open weekdays from 06:30 to 10:00 and on Saturdays from 10:30 to 12:30, the ticket office ensures you can secure your tickets conveniently. For those preferring digital avenues, ticket machines are available, and they are equipped to handle online ticket collections as well. Accessibility is prioritized with features such as Induction Loops to assist those with hearing impairments, and step-free access across parts of the station ensures mobility for all.
However, travelers should plan accordingly as the station lacks some amenities such as luggage storage, waiting rooms, and accessible toilets. While refreshment facilities are available, with a quaint coffee kiosk and nearby local shops, the absence of an ATM and currency exchange facilities is notable; planning cash needs in advance might save any hassle. The cycling-friendly station provides storage stands, although sheltered options aren't available.
Connections from Carpenders Park are facilitated by thoughtful arrangements. While traveling southbound to Euston or northbound to Watford Junction, rail replacement bus services are strategically distributed with easy access from bus stops B and C on Prestwick Road. For a more personal transit, taxis can usually be found at the station's forecourt, ensuring you’re never far from your next destination.
